Hope City, Arkansas Census 2020 Total Hispanic and Non-Hispanic Voting-age Population

Updated on February 22, 2026.

According to the data from the US 2020 decennial Census, as at April 2020, among the total 6,349 of the Hope City, AR voting-age population (18 years and over), 5,084 residents identified as Non-Hispanic (80.08%), and 1,265 residents identified as Hispanic or Latino (19.92%).
